Technical Field
The utility model relates to the technical field of full-automatic paper mounting machines, in particular to a paper sheet automatic supporting frame of a full-automatic paper mounting machine.
Background
The common paper mounting machine is a semi-automatic Ping Zhangdui flat paper mounting machine and is used for single-sided paperboard cladding, local and integral mounting, gray paperboard local and integral cladding, mounting and windowing of double-sided labels and a full-linkage paper mounting machine specially designed for short tile lines for producing narrow-width paper.
When the existing paper mounting machine is operated, a finished stack of paperboards is placed on the conveying belt of the paper mounting machine manually, so that manual seat carrying is needed when discharging is needed each time, the manual labor is increased for a long time, the feeding speed of the device is reduced, and the stacking is needed manually sometimes because of different feeding amounts, the practicability of the device is further reduced, and the limitation of the device is further increased.

The lifting mechanism comprises a second vertical plate 24, the second vertical plate 24 is fixedly connected to the bottom of the storage box 1, one side of the second vertical plate 24 is rotationally connected with a reciprocating screw rod 31, the outer side of the reciprocating screw rod 31 is in threaded connection with a displacement block 28, the bottom of the lifting plate 22 is fixedly connected with a first fixed block 23, a second connecting rod 32 is rotationally connected between the displacement block 28 and the first fixed block 23, one side of the storage box 1 is fixedly provided with a driving motor 15, and one end of an output shaft of the driving motor 15 is fixedly connected with one end of the reciprocating screw rod 31.
The lifting mechanism further comprises a second fixed block 26, the second fixed block 26 is fixedly connected to the bottom of the storage box 1, a third vertical plate 27 is fixedly connected to the bottom of the lifting plate 22, a sliding rod 16 is fixedly connected between the third vertical plate 27 and the inner wall of the storage box 1, a sliding block 17 is slidably connected to the outer side of the sliding rod 16, and a first connecting rod 25 is rotatably connected between the sliding block 17 and the second fixed block 26.
The bottom of the storage box 1 is provided with a second limiting groove 30, a second limiting block 29 is slidably connected in the second limiting groove 30, and the top of the second limiting block 29 is fixedly connected with the bottom of the displacement block 28. When lifting the lifting plate 22, the output shaft of the driving motor 15 drives the reciprocating screw rod 31 to rotate and simultaneously drives the displacement block 28 to move, so that the second connecting rod 32 is driven to rotate between the displacement block 28 and the first fixed block 23, then the first connecting rod 25 is driven to rotate between the sliding block 17 and the second fixed block 26 and simultaneously drive the sliding block 17 to slide outside the sliding rod 16, then the lifting plate 22 is driven to move in the storage box 1, then the second limiting block 29 is driven to slide in the second limiting groove 30 when the displacement block 28 moves, and the displacement block 28 is prevented from deviating when moving, so that the practicability of the device is improved.
Wherein, stop gear includes first riser 20, first riser 20 fixed connection is at the top of lifting board 22, and first riser 20's inside sliding connection has guide bar 18, and the outside cover of guide bar 18 has spring 21, and lifting board 22's top sliding connection has conflict board 19, and one end and the one side fixed connection of conflict board 19 of guide bar 18, the both ends of spring 21 respectively with one side of conflict board 19 and one side fixed connection of first riser 20. The bottom through the paper when placing the paper on lifting board 22 is inconsistent with the inclined plane of conflict board 19 to drive conflict board 19 removal drive guide bar 18 and compress spring 21 simultaneously in the inside slip of first riser 20, then carry out preliminary location to the paper through the effort of spring 21, when lifting board 22 removes like this, the problem that scatters can not appear, thereby increased the stability of device.
Wherein, displacement mechanism includes electric telescopic handle 6, and electric telescopic handle 6 fixed mounting is in one side of fourth riser 34, and electric telescopic handle 6 movable rod's one end and one side fixed connection of push plate 7, first spacing groove 8 has been seted up to the inside of curb plate 4, and the inside sliding connection of first spacing groove 8 has dead lever 33, and the one end of dead lever 33 and one side fixed connection of push plate 7, the one end fixedly connected with first stopper 5 of dead lever 33. When the paper is pushed onto the conveyor belt 12, the movable rod of the electric telescopic rod 6 drives the pushing plate 7 to move and simultaneously drives the fixing rod 33 to slide in the first limiting groove 8, so that the position of the pushing plate 7 is limited, the stability of the device is further improved, one side of the pushing plate 7 pushes one side of the paper, and the paper enters the top of the conveyor belt 12 through the guide roller 9, so that the working efficiency of the device is improved.
Wherein, mount one side of paper machine body 13 fixed mounting has controller 10, and driving motor 15 and electric telescopic handle 6 all with controller 10 electric connection.
